DISPLAY_CYCLE:

Sets the cycle of LCD display. The factory default
setting of the display cycle is 2: 400ms. The valid
range can be selected from below;

1: 200ms
2: 400ms
3: 1s
4: 2s
5: 4s
6: 8s

If the low temperature environment makes it difficult
to view the display, it is recommended that you set a
longer display cycle.

PRIMARY_VALUE_TYPE:

Indicates the measuring value type used in
PRIMARY_VALUE. Valid range are as follows;

100: mass flow
101: volumetric flow
102: average mass flow
103: average volumetric flow
65535: other

Factory default is 101: volumetric flow.

ALARM_PERFORM

(1)

Overview
This parameter masks Alarm/Warning. By
setting "0" to each bit, corresponding
Alarm/Warning are cleared. When masked the
corresponding bit of DEVICE_STATUS
becomes OFF and no alarm is displayed on
LCD, and also becomes out of scope of
Primary value status, ED_ERROR setting.
